Foundation renovation services involve assessing and repairing the structural base of a property to ensure stability and safety. Over time, foundations can develop issues such as cracking, settling, or shifting due to soil movement, moisture changes, or age. These problems can compromise the integrity of a home, leading to uneven floors, sticking doors, or more serious structural concerns.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to reinforce or rebuild foundations, helping to restore the stability of the property and prevent further damage.

Many foundation problems are caused by environmental factors like fluctuating moisture levels or poor drainage, which can lead to soil erosion or expansion beneath the foundation. Additionally, properties that have experienced previous settling or have undergone significant renovations may develop issues requiring foundation work. Homeowners often turn to foundation renovation when they notice symptoms such as cracked walls, uneven flooring, or gaps around door and window frames. Addressing these issues promptly can help maintain the property's value and safety.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Renovation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Platteville,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or foundation fixes such as crack sealing or patching typically range from $250-$600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Pier and Beam Support - elevating or stabilizing foundation supports usually costs between $1,000-$3,500. Larger, more involved proj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most jobs stay within this typical band.

Full Foundation Replacement - complete replacement or major reconstruction can range from $10,000-$30,000+, with complex projects exceeding this range. Many local contractors handle standard replacements within the lower to mid part of this spectrum.

Basement Waterproofing - waterproofing services often cost between $2,000-$7,000, depending on the size and severity of issues. Many projects fall into the $3,000-$5,000 range, with fewer reaching the highest tiers for extensive work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a foundation needs renovation? Common ind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around the foundation perimeter.

How do local contractors typically approach foundation repairs? They assess the condition of the foundation, determine the underlying issues, and recommend appropriate solutions such as underpinning, wall stabilization, or crack repair.

Can foundation renovation improve the safety of my home? Yes, addressing foundation issues can help prevent further structural damage and maintain the overall safety and stability of the building.

What types of foundation materials are commonly repaired or replaced? Common materials include concrete, brick, stone, and block foundations, each requiring specific repair techniques based on their condition.
